Web29 de fev. de 2016 · Merriam-Webster’s lists e- (which stands for “electronic”) as a “combining form.”. This means e- functions not on its own but only as part of another word. The dictionary notes, moreover, that use of e- as a combining form derives from the word “e-mail.”. Some other e- words are listed, including “e-book” and “e-commerce.”. Web6 de jan. de 2024 · Jan 6, 2024. #3. Both sentences are correct. Compound adjectives in front of a noun are usually hyphenated to make the meaning clearer. Personally I would not hyphenate "on site" in the first sentence because I read it is a preposition and noun rather than a compound adjective.
